T C's Radio Repair
Closed
Advertisement
9275 US Highway 117 N
Willard, NC 28478
T C's Radio Repair is a local business in Willard, NC that specializes in repairing radios and related electronic devices.
With a focus on providing quality service, they aim to help customers with their radio repair needs in a timely and efficient manner.
Generated from their business information
See a problem?
You might also like
Advertisement